Edward Woodrow Anderson, age 84 of Decherd, passed away on Tuesday, September 6, 2022, at his residence surrounded by his loving family. A native of Franklin County, he was born in Decherd on December 6, 1937 to the late Edgar Issac and Alma Jessie (Pharr) Anderson. Before his retirement, he was employed as the plant manager at Diversatech. In his spare time, he enjoyed rebuilding antique cars, and dune buggies and motorcycles. But most of all, Edward enjoyed spending time getting together with his beloved family. In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his grandsons, David Edward Steele and Dalton Max Wiseman; sister, Dolly Mae Anderson; and brother, Wills Anderson. Edward is survived by his loving wife of sixty-five years, Patricia Ann Anderson of Decherd; children, Julie (David) Steele of Tullahoma, Linda (Bruce) Semke of Decherd, Tommy (Susan) Anderson of Belvidere, Lori (Jamie) Sons of Decherd, and James (Donna) Anderson of Decherd; siblings, Thelma Sue Baker of Manchester, Plesey Reynolds Anderson of Decherd, and Walter Robert (April) Anderson of Decherd; grandchildren, Brandy (Ruben) Jones, Moranda Steele, EAmilya (Dillon) Hendon, Laithen Steele, Heavnli Steele, Deanna Baker, Haley Boyd, Jaycee Baker, Jessie McClure, Jodi McGuire, Chris (Melissa) Hall, Grason Archery, Tabitha (Matt) Johnson, Samuel Anderson, Amanda Wiseman, Bubba (Britteny) Wiseman and Dustin Wiseman; twenty-three great-grandchildren; and three great-great-grandchildren. No services are planned at this time. Moore-Cortner Funeral Home, 300 First Ave NW, Winchester, TN 37398, (931)-967-2222
